Havertys Furniture Companies, Inc. announced a 7.7% increase in net sales for the second quarter of 2026, driven by strong comp-store sales and effective design services, despite a challenging housing market.

Havertys announced a 4.1% increase in net sales for the first quarter of 2026, driven by strong comparable store sales and increased utilization of its in-home design services.

Havertys Furniture Companies reported a 10.6% increase in net sales for Q3 2025, reaching $194.5 million, despite a challenging housing market and new tariff impacts.

Havertys Furniture reports a slight increase in Q2 2025 net sales but a decline in six-month net income and earnings per share, navigating new tariffs and a soft housing market.

Haverty Furniture Companies, Inc. reports a slight decrease in net sales for the first quarter of 2025, impacted by a weak housing market, inflationary pressures, and atypical winter weather.

Havertys experienced a substantial decrease in sales and comparable store sales during the third quarter of 2024, reflecting broader economic challenges and reduced consumer spending.

Havertys experienced a decrease in sales and earnings for the second quarter of 2024, impacted by reduced consumer spending and a weakened housing market.

Haverty Furniture Companies experienced a significant decrease in sales and earnings for the first quarter of 2024, primarily due to economic uncertainty and reduced consumer spending.
